Data Pro

Data Pro

WebGL Three.js Developer

Salary

≈ $12 300/mo

Details

Level
Junior
Format
Remote
Location
Remote
Category
Development
English
Maybe required
Apply

Description

Engagement: Contract (Immediate start) Duration: 24 weeks (extension likely)

Role Overview We are seeking an experienced WebGL / Three.js developer to modernize and enhance a legacy 3D visualization into a high-quality, investor-ready demo. The work focuses on performance, visual polish, and modern Three.js architecture.

Responsibilities Upgrade and refactor legacy Three.js code to modern standards Build and optimize 3D particle systems and scene interactions Implement lighting, post-processing (bloom, depth of field), and camera controls Optimize performance for large 4K displays Collaborate with product and design on a polished demo experience

Required Skills Strong experience with Three.js / WebGL Modern JavaScript (ES6+); TypeScript preferred Experience optimizing real-time 3D scenes (60fps target) Solid understanding of cameras, lighting, and post-processing

Preferred React + Three.js (react-three-fiber) Shader/GLSL experience Vite or modern build tools